Output ad103269499faffbc67c4f7b65a0051deb37cb5b87b299845f8a76cae0d48406:41

value
713034
script pubkey
OP_0 OP_PUSHBYTES_20 03896767270217b66f2a9d134eb395323b186c62
address
bc1qqwykwee8qgtmvme2n5f5avu4xga3smrzwfrzzx
transaction
ad103269499faffbc67c4f7b65a0051deb37cb5b87b299845f8a76cae0d48406
spent
true